PROCEDURE
实验过程
42 g (0.036 mol) of anhydrous potassium carbonate are added to a solution of 72.0 g (0.36 mol) of 2,4-dichloro-5-nitrothiazole in 300 ml of acetonitrile. A solution of 28.2 g (0.3 mol) of phenol in 300 ml of acetonitrile is then added dropwise at 15° C. to 20° C. in the course of about 1.5 hours and the mixture is subsequently stirred at the same temperature for a further 0.5 hour. It is then heated at the reflux temperature for 15 minutes, cooled to room temperature and then stirred into 3 liters of ice-water and the precipitate is filtered off, washed with water and dried. To remove excess 2,4-dichloro-5-nitrothiazole, the product is stirred in 500 ml of petroleum ether at about 20° C., filtered off, washed with petroleum ether and dried. 75.4 g (98.0% of theory) of 4-chloro-5-nitro-2-phenoxythiazole are thus obtained. Melting point 96° C. (from petroleum ether).
